Noble Capital Markets, a full-service investment banking firm with over 40 years of experience, is seeking a Sales Representative to join our team at our Boca Raton headquarters. This role will be filled at a level — Junior, Mid, or Senior — commensurate with the candidate's experience.
Noble is a leading provider of Company-Sponsored Research (CSR) in North America, distributed through our proprietary platform, Channelchek®. In this role, you will be responsible for growing client relationships and driving new business by introducing publicly traded companies to our CSR platform — with scope of responsibility (from supporting senior team members to independently managing a full pipeline and closing business) scaling with your level of experience.
